The 113 Waterman computer labs received a couple of updates today:

1) All new CAT-6 network cables have been installed, replacing the older CAT-5 and CAT-5e ones that had been there for probably a decade or more. Hopefully this will help with intermittent network connectivity issues that seem to randomly appear and disappear throughout the semester.

2) A graphical window has been added to the login/logout scripts that run automatically on login and logout. Previously you'd just see a blank screen, now you'll get some feedback that something is happening.

That's it! Let me know of any questions or problems you notice as a result of these changes.
